π Key Responsibilities
β
Gathering business, marketing, and technical requirements to create scalable solutions
β
Planning data management and flow for advanced marketing automation
β
Defining standards and processes to enhance marketing workflows and use technology to improve quality of work
β
Defining integration points between marketing automation systems and other systems
β
Defining logical and high-level physical architecture based on available infrastructure
β
Proactively identifying and resolving data flow issues
β
Staying up-to-date with market trends and new technologies in marketing automation
β
Ensuring compliance with market standards in the built solution
β
Validating detailed business requirements and reflecting them in the solution architecture
β
Collaborating closely with other project teams: CRM, data, and integration

π― Required Qualifications
Education: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field
Experience: Minimum 5 years of experience in IT, with 3 years working with Adobe Experience Platform, Adobe RT-CDP, AJO, CJA, Marketo, Adobe Target, Adobe Campaign
Required Skills:
- Proven experience in Adobe Experience Platform, Adobe RT-CDP, AJO, CJA, Marketo, Adobe Target, Adobe Campaign
- Strong knowledge of MarTech tools (personalization, optimization, DSP solutions)
- Proficiency in HTML, CSS, JavaScript
- Understanding of B2B and B2C marketing campaign management processes
- Experience leading an Adobe Experience Platform project to build advanced automation and campaign paths
- Excellent communication skills, both technical and non-technical (including English)
- Strong understanding of solution design, relational databases, data management, and ETL processes
Preferred Skills:
- Certifications in Adobe Experience Platform or related tools
- Experience with additional MarTech tools
